1. The Evolution of Fire Detection: From 9V to Sealed Lithium
To understand the value of a 10-year battery, we must look at the history of fire safety. Traditional smoke alarms relied on zinc-carbon or alkaline 9-volt batteries. While effective, these batteries had a high discharge rate and required replacement every 6 to 12 months.
Statistics from fire departments globally show a tragic trend: a significant percentage of fire-related fatalities occur in homes where smoke alarms were present but non-functional due to missing or dead batteries. Homeowners would often "borrow" the battery for a TV remote or remove it entirely to stop a nuisance alarm during cooking, intending to replace it later but eventually forgetting.
The 10-year sealed lithium battery was engineered to solve this human error. By sealing a high-density power source inside the unit at the factory, the device is designed to remain powered for its entire functional life.
2. Why "10 Years"? Understanding the Lifespan of Sensors
You might wonder, why specifically ten years? Why not twenty?
The 10-year limit isn't just about the battery; it’s about the sensor technology. Whether an alarm is ionization-based (detecting fast-flaming fires) or photoelectric-based (detecting slow-smoldering fires), the components that detect smoke particles degrade over time. Dust, humidity, and microscopic insects can accumulate inside the sensing chamber, potentially desensitizing the unit or causing frequent false alarms.
Fire safety experts and organizations like the National Fire Protection Association (NFPA) and European standards like EN 14604 recommend replacing the entire smoke detector unit every 10 years. Therefore, matching the battery life to the sensor life is a logical and safety-oriented engineering choice. When the battery finally dies, it serves as a mandatory reminder that the sensor itself is no longer reliable.
3. The Photoelectric Advantage: Modern Detection for Modern Homes
Most high-quality 10-year battery smoke detectors today utilize photoelectric sensing technology.
Modern homes are filled with synthetic materials—polyurethane foam in sofas, polyester fabrics, and plastic electronics. These materials tend to smolder for a long time before erupting into open flames. Photoelectric sensors are significantly better at detecting these "large-particle" smoldering fires, often giving residents precious extra minutes to escape.
Furthermore, photoelectric alarms are less prone to "nuisance alarms" caused by cooking steam or shower vapor. This is crucial because a homeowner who experiences fewer false alarms is less likely to attempt to disable the device.
4. Legal Compliance: The Shift in Global Legislation
If you live in regions like Scotland, parts of Germany, or several U.S. states (like California or New York), 10-year sealed battery smoke alarms are no longer a suggestion—they are the law.
For instance, the Scottish 2022 Legislation mandated that every home must have interlinked smoke alarms with a sealed battery or a hardwired connection. Similarly, German building codes (under DIN 14676) emphasize the importance of certified devices that meet the EN 14604 standard.
By installing a 10-year battery unit, you aren't just protecting your family; you are ensuring your property meets modern insurance requirements and local safety ordinances, which can be a critical factor during home appraisals or insurance claims.
5. Maintenance: "Set it and Forget it" is a Myth
While a 10-year battery eliminates the need for battery changes, it does not eliminate the need for maintenance. To ensure your device remains in peak condition, you should follow the "Test and Dust" rule:
-
Monthly Testing: Every smoke detector has a test button. Pressing it ensures the circuitry and siren are functioning.
-
Vacuuming: At least twice a year, use a vacuum cleaner with a soft brush attachment to clear the vents around the alarm. This prevents dust buildup from causing false triggers.
-
Check the Date: Look for the "Replace By" date on the side of the unit. Even if it seems to be working, a sensor older than 10 years is an unreliable sensor.
6. Smart Interconnectivity: The Future of Home Safety
The ultimate evolution of the 10-year smoke detector is interconnectivity. In a large home, a fire starting in the garage might not be heard by someone sleeping in a third-floor bedroom.
Interlinked 10-year alarms use Radio Frequency (RF) or Wi-Fi to communicate. If one alarm detects smoke, all alarms in the house sound simultaneously. This "One Starts, All Start" system provides the maximum possible warning time, allowing families to evacuate safely regardless of where the fire originates.
